The time would depend on some variables. Unless the hawk is flying directly over the rabbit there would more than 60 ft between it and the rabbit. Hawks do not normally dive straight down, they dive more at an angle in order to catch their prey in their claws and continue to fly off with it. Another vairable would be if the rabbit would run after spotting the hawk coming toward it.
